About This Item

Paris: Marpon et Flammarion (26, rue Racine) [et] Librairie Physiologique (38, boulevard St.-Germain), 1882 . . . et Ch. Dufaure de la Prade. Édition elzévirienne. Deuxième mille.    ¶ Twelve "méditations" -- (1) La mariage selon la physiologie expérimentale, (2) La manière d'habiter et de faire génération, (3) L'appareil générateur du genre humain, (4) Le spasme génésique chez l'homme et chez la femme, (5) Le théologie et la fonction génésiaque, (6) Les instruments de l'amour experimental, (7) Règles à suivre dans l'art de fair l'amour, (8) Les symphonies conjugales de l'amour, (9) L'épouse incomprise et le mari battu, (10) Hygiène physique et morale de l'amour, (11) Le fécondation de l'épouse, (12) Les devoirs physiologiques de l'époux --; together with a Notice biographique sur le dr Jules Guyot (pages [135]-154) and a Lexique du Bréviaire de l'amour experimental ([155]-174). The colophon (page [181]) is dated 31 May 1882.   ||| Collation: In 8s (122 x 81 mm): 94 leaves, paginated [i-ii], [1-9] 10-179 [180-186]. Pages [i-ii] and [183-186] are blank as issued.  Binding: Fine three-quarter brown morocco lettered in gilt, patterned boards, patterned endpapers, 2 + 2 flyleaves, green-yellow-and-red register and headbands, top-edges gilt, unsigned, preserving the original printed wrappers bound in; bound en suite with Barral Missel de l'amour sentimental (1884) qv .  Condition: Very good, joints trifle rubbed.  Provenance: Beatrice Reiter Leval (1911-2004), of New York, picture-collector.   ||| For further details please contact Jay Dillon  Rare Books + Manuscripts, as below.  Pour plus de détails, veuillez contacter Jay Dillon  Rare Books + Manuscripts, comme ci-dessous..
